Sciatica is a condition characterized by pain that travels along the path of the sciatic nerve, which branches from the lower back through the hips and down each leg. Typically, sciatica affects only one side of the body and can range from mild discomfort to severe, debilitating pain. What Are Sciatica Support Strategies?
Sciatica support strategies encompass a range of methods designed to alleviate symptoms and improve quality of life. These approaches often combine physical therapy, lifestyle modifications, and targeted exercises that strengthen the muscles supporting the spine. Physical therapists may recommend specific stretching routines that focus on the hamstrings, lower back, and hip flexors to reduce tension on the sciatic nerve. Additionally, core strengthening exercises help stabilize the spine and prevent future episodes. Heat and cold therapy remain popular adjunct treatments, with cold packs reducing inflammation during acute flare-ups and heat promoting blood flow during recovery phases. Many individuals also explore complementary methods such as yoga and Pilates, which emphasize controlled movements and body awareness.
How Do Nerve Pressure Insights Inform Treatment?
Understanding nerve pressure is fundamental to addressing sciatica effectively. The sciatic nerve can become compressed or irritated due to herniated discs, bone spurs, spinal stenosis, or muscle tightness in the piriformis muscle. Recent research has highlighted the importance of identifying the specific source of nerve compression to tailor interventions appropriately. Diagnostic imaging such as MRI scans can reveal structural abnormalities, while physical examinations help assess nerve function and pain patterns. Insights into nerve pressure have led to more precise treatment protocols that address the underlying mechanical issues rather than simply masking symptoms. For instance, if a herniated disc is the culprit, decompression techniques and targeted exercises may be prioritized. When muscle tightness contributes to nerve irritation, manual therapy and myofascial release techniques can provide relief.
What Are Non-Invasive Pain Approaches?
Non-invasive pain approaches have gained considerable attention as individuals seek alternatives to surgical interventions and long-term medication use. These methods include spinal manipulation performed by chiropractors or osteopathic physicians, which aims to improve spinal alignment and reduce nerve irritability. Acupuncture, an ancient practice rooted in traditional Chinese medicine, has shown promise in some studies for reducing sciatica-related discomfort by stimulating specific points along the body’s meridians. Transcutaneous electrical nerve stimulation (TENS) units deliver mild electrical pulses through the skin to interrupt pain signals. Additionally, emerging technologies such as laser therapy and ultrasound therapy are being explored for their potential to reduce inflammation and promote tissue healing. Mindfulness-based stress reduction and cognitive behavioral therapy address the psychological components of chronic pain, helping individuals develop coping strategies and reduce pain perception.
Why Is Mobility and Posture Research Important?
Mobility and posture research plays a critical role in both preventing and managing sciatica. Poor posture, whether from prolonged sitting, improper lifting techniques, or muscle imbalances, can place excessive stress on the lower back and sciatic nerve. Studies have shown that maintaining a neutral spine position during daily activities reduces the risk of nerve compression. Mobility exercises that promote flexibility in the hips, hamstrings, and lower back can alleviate tension and improve overall spinal health. Researchers are also investigating the relationship between sedentary lifestyles and sciatica prevalence, with findings suggesting that regular movement breaks and dynamic sitting options can mitigate risk. Postural assessments conducted by physical therapists or occupational therapists can identify specific imbalances and guide corrective exercise programs. Emerging wearable technology that monitors posture in real-time is also being developed to provide individuals with immediate feedback and encourage healthier movement patterns.
How Can Ergonomic Adjustments Help?
Ergonomic adjustments in the workplace and home environment can significantly impact sciatica symptoms and prevention. Proper workstation setup is essential for individuals who spend extended periods sitting. This includes adjusting chair height so that feet rest flat on the floor, positioning computer monitors at eye level to prevent neck strain, and using lumbar support cushions to maintain the natural curve of the lower back. Sit-stand desks allow for position changes throughout the day, reducing prolonged pressure on the spine. For those who perform manual labor or repetitive tasks, ergonomic training on proper lifting techniques and body mechanics can prevent injury. At home, choosing supportive mattresses and pillows that promote spinal alignment during sleep is equally important. Footwear also plays a role, as shoes with adequate arch support and cushioning can reduce impact forces that travel up the kinetic chain to the lower back. Small modifications, such as using a footrest or adjusting car seat positioning, can collectively make a meaningful difference in symptom management.
Comparison of Non-Invasive Management Options
| Approach | Provider Type | Key Features |
|---|---|---|
| Physical Therapy | Licensed Physical Therapist | Customized exercise programs, manual therapy, education on body mechanics |
| Chiropractic Care | Doctor of Chiropractic | Spinal adjustments, mobilization techniques, lifestyle counseling |
| Acupuncture | Licensed Acupuncturist | Needle insertion at specific points, holistic pain management, minimal side effects |
| TENS Therapy | Self-administered or supervised | Portable device, adjustable intensity, drug-free pain relief |
| Yoga/Pilates | Certified Instructor | Mind-body connection, flexibility and strength training, stress reduction |
